Im newbie here and I would like to ask you for your opinion about Ozzys autograph which I got few weeks ago. Im not autograph buyer / seller, basically I have autographs of artist who I admire and which I got personally (almost all in my collection), and I dont know how to describe the story about this Ozzy signature - it probably dont fit into category "personally obtained autographs". Basically - I would have absolutely no doubts about it but when I read the story about Brian Wilson, it got me confused. Fact - I did not see Ozzy to sign it (these signs are the only ones which are absolutely clear). How it happened? Ozzy´s tourmanager asked us to give him some stuff to get it signed, he went into the the hotel and gave it us back maybe 10 minutes later? There were just nine fans, I think that he would not have to offer it to us (but he did it), and we saw Ozzy to go into his limo as he went to the soundcheck. This is the story how it happened at his hotel, I really believe that its Ozzys sign and not something like "Brian Wilson" signs...
